GEARMATIC G5 AXTRANS SAE 75W-80 API GL-5 (SYNTHETIC) 4L
High performance heavy-duty synthetic manual transmission fluid for use in heavy duty truck synchronized commercial vehicle manual transmission systems. It specially tunes friction characteristics to contribute smooth shifting performance, and extreme pressure (EP) protection promotes resistance to component scuffing and wear, helping reduce the frequency of maintenance.

Formulated with synthetic base fluids in combination with a high performance additive system and offers a drain capability of up to 300,000 km or 3 years. It meets the MAN specifications MAN 342 Type M3 and MAN 341 Type Z2 for total driveline applications and is suitable for use for DAF, IVECO, RENAULT and VOLVO commercial vehicles.

Key Benefits

  • Superior wear protection under extreme pressure conditions.
  • Enhanced thermal stability reduces deposit formation and oxidation.
  • Optimized viscosity control for consistent performance across various temperatures.
  • Extended gear life through reduced friction and improved load-bearing capability.
  • Longer oil drain intervals, up to 300,000 km or 3 years, outperforming conventional mineral-based transmission fluids.
